So what is a backup of your Lenovo Vibe X2
A backup is a picture of your Lenovo Vibe X2 content. In case of complications, it will allow you to return your device to the same state as when you produced the back-up.
The different types of backup
When ever you desire to generate a back-up of its Lenovo Vibe X2, you might know that there are several types of back-up.
- First there is the System Backup: it will be the backup of the Android OS that is on your Lenovo Vibe X2. It is applied to register the os and its options. Consequently it’s an Android backup.
- You then have the data backup: this corresponds to the recording of all your data. The data includes your tracks, pics, movies and all other kind of data files that are stored on your Lenovo Vibe X2.
- Finally, you have the applications backup: it will allow to keep the whole set of applications that you have set up on the Lenovo Vibe X2. This is convenient because it avoids reinstalling all your applications in case of concern.

How to make backups on Lenovo Vibe X2
Make an Android backup on your Lenovo Vibe X2
The backup of Android will allow you to back up Android and your preferences (wifi networks for example). To accomplish this, you will need to go to the Lenovo Vibe X2 parameter menu and after that click on Backup and Reset. Now that you are there, you only need to select or create a Backup account and switch on the option: Save my data.

Backup installed apps with Helium
Making a backup of your applications is really convenient in many situations. Indeed, it allows not to lose settings, security passwords or games backups. To generate a backup of the applications of your Lenovo Vibe X2, you must employ a third-party app. The app in question is Helium, it allows the backup of your applications without needing to root your Lenovo Vibe X2. You need to download and set up Helium on your mobile phone. Once completed, you can start the app on your Lenovo Vibe X2 and just select the applications to save before hitting OK. You can after that choose the storage location for the backup. You can therefore select internal storage or synchronization with an additional device if you have an account. Now that the location is selected, the backup runs. If perhaps you desire to restore applications, you will simply have to go to the Restore and Sync tab and decide on the app to restore.
